我刚刚从Go Daddy购买了一个带有SQL Server数据库的托管帐户,我正在尝试使用VS Pro连接到它。我已经尝试了所有我能想到的东西,并且也称为Go Daddy。我的机器上有SQL Server 2008,但是Go Daddy有SQL Server 2005 - 我肯定会带来更多的问题......
在我的服务器资源管理器中,我点击了图标以添加新服务器。出现了diologue并要求输入服务器名称。我的用户名和密码与我的用户名和密码不同,所以我点击链接输入我的信用卡。之后我使用了服务器名称(或Go Daddy称之为数据源),格式为-mydatabasename.db.7numbers.hostedresource.com
我不断收到错误信息“确保机器名称和路径有效”。
我也尝试过使用服务器资源管理器中的“连接数据库”图标,尝试了我能想到的所有组合。有没有人经历过这个可能有一些想法让我尝试?
这只是我感到沮丧的一天,但不能放弃......请帮忙!
答案 0 :(得分:1)
出于安全原因,您的托管服务器可能不允许以这种方式进行远程连接。否则,一些黑客会拥有你的盒子而不是你。您需要使用Go Daddy的工具来管理您的环境,而不是直接从开发框连接。
答案 1 :(得分:0)
我可以为自己嘲笑这个 - 当我最初设置数据库时,我选中了一个框以使其只读 - 不允许访问进行更改。我创建了一个新的,这次我允许访问,并可以在我的Web配置文件中添加一个字符串,它连接到它。有时这是让我们感到兴奋的小事......